Civil War Store Cards are a unique type of collectible coin issued during the American Civil War, primarily in Missouri. These tokens were produced by local merchants and businesses as a means of currency due to the scarcity of official coins during that period. Often made of materials such as copper or brass, they feature distinctive designs, typically including the merchant's name or logo, and served as a way to facilitate trade within the local economy. Collectors value these tokens for their historical significance and connection to the Civil War era.
